As a Technical Business Analyst at Livestock Information, you’ll be right at the centre of shaping digital services that matter. You’ll work across the organisation to turn complex business needs into clear, actionable requirements that power great digital products.

You’ll bring people together — from stakeholders and product teams to architects and developers — to explore ideas, define outcomes, and design scalable, future-proof solutions. Using tools like BPMN, you’ll uncover opportunities to improve how we work, while supporting delivery teams to refine backlogs and build solutions that deliver real value.

It’s a fast-moving, collaborative role that blends technical know-how, business insight, and strong communication — and gives you the chance to make a genuine impact through the services you help deliver.

Responsibilities

Your responsibilities will include

  • Conducting detailed business and technical requirements analysis in collaboration with business stakeholders and technical teams.
  • Eliciting, analysing, validating, and documenting business requirements to ensure a clear understanding of needs and desired outcomes.
  • Translating business requirements into clear, structured, and testable functional and non-functional requirements.
  • Supporting the design of scalable and sustainable IT solutions that meet business needs, working closely with architects and development teams.
  • Modelling current and future business processes using BPMN or similar frameworks to identify improvement opportunities.
  • Acting as a key liaison between business units and technical teams, ensuring clear, consistent communication throughout the delivery lifecycle.
  • Collaborating with Product Owners and Architects to understand product roadmaps, priorities, and technical constraints.
  • Supporting the development and refinement of product backlogs, including epics, features, and user stories, ensuring they are well-defined and ready for development.
  • Working with development teams during delivery to clarify requirements and support correct implementation.
  • Participating in agile ceremonies, including sprint planning, refinement, reviews, and retrospectives.
  • Documenting business processes, user journeys, and functional designs to support solution development and change adoption.
  • Supporting data-related analysis required to inform requirements and solution design, working alongside data and reporting specialists where appropriate.
  • Contributing to service design and business change activities to support smooth transition into live operation.
  • Identifying and documenting risks, assumptions, issues, dependencies, and decisions related to requirements and scope.
  • Supporting delivery planning and progress tracking in collaboration with Project Managers or Delivery Leads.
  • Providing walkthroughs or demonstrations of functionality to stakeholders to support understanding and acceptance.
  • Identifying opportunities for continuous improvement in processes, tools, and ways of working

What you need to know about the Edinburgh Tech Scene

From traditional pubs and centuries-old universities to sleek shopping malls and glass-paneled office buildings, Edinburgh's architecture reflects its unique blend of history and modernity. But the fusion of past and future isn't just visible in its buildings; it's also shaping the city's economy. Named the United Kingdom's leading technology ecosystem outside of London, Edinburgh plays host to major global companies like Apple and Adobe, as well as a growing number of innovative startups in fields like cybersecurity, finance and healthcare.
